Mulheim
Wins Canadian Sprint Car Championships &
Geldart
Crowned 2004 Southern Ontario Sprints Champion

Bill
Oldroyd
Ohsweken
Speedway September 18, 2004
The
Southern Ontario Sprints 2004 season is now in the
history books with the running of the Canadian Sprint
Car Championships and once again, the closer was a real
thriller. Nick
Mulheim of Ohio, who is a regular with the
Michigan-based Sprints on Dirt series, captured the
prestigious CSCC title while Cody Geldart from Mossley
was officially crowned the 2004 SOS Champion.
John
Riegling of Chatham paced the twenty-five-car field to
the green and immediately jumped into the lead with Brad
Knab from Delevan, NY and Mulheim in hot pursuit.
The SOS Rookie of the Year Jack Pillon, from
Belle River brought out the first caution of the night
with a spin in turn two on the third lap and on the
restart, Knab was able to take over the top spot.
Adam West of Ridgetown got around Mulheim for
third and within a couple of laps was up into second
challenging Knab for the lead.
On
lap eight, Pillon would see his rookie season come to an
abrupt end as he flipped in turn two bring out the red
flag. Fortunately
Pillon was not injured in the crash but he sprint car
had to be cradled off the track.
On the restart, West became the third leader of
the night as he dove under Knab in turn one to take over
the top spot. For
several laps, West, Knab and Mulheim would do battle,
running side-by-side much of the time.
Turn
two would continue to be the trouble spot on this night.
On lap ten, Paul Ballantyne of Brantford lost
control in this turn and did at least three,
three-sixties making contact with Tim Phillips from
Grand Island, NY. Phillips
would receive damage to his front end causing him to
spin in turn three and forcing him to retire.
However, Ballantyne was able to regain control
and keep running but under the caution, he did stop to
check for damage putting him back to twenty-second
position. He
would fight back to finish a respectable twelfth.
On
lap twelve, Riegling would spin in corner two bringing
out the third caution of the night and then one lap
later, last years CSCC winner Keith Dempster of Alton
would tangle with the John Schuyler from Jamestown, NY
forcing the final caution of the night.
Schuyler was able to keep going while Dempster
came to a stop. Dempster
would re-join the field in twentysecond position
without his front wing but would battle back to earn a
top ten finish.
Mulheim
became the forth and final leader of the night when he
was able to make a pass on West with ten laps remaining
in the twenty-five lap event.
He successfully negotiated the lapped traffic
during the balance of the race to take home the victory
and the CSCC Title.
West would come up one position short with a
second place finish.
Geldart
ran a very steady race to finish in third position and
with his start, secured the 2004 SOS Title.
At only sixteen years of age, Geldart has already
proven that he has what it takes to become a champion
and there is no doubt that he has a very promising
career ahead of him if he chooses to remain in racing.
The
forth place finish would go to John Schuyler from
Jamestown NY who was racing with the SOS for the first
time. Taking
the fifth position was Knab who ran in the top five all
night and led the event early.
Glenn
Styres of Ohsweken had an up and down night as he was
actually up to third at one point but late in the race
he did a three-sixty in turn two dropping him back to
ninth. He
would battle back to finish in sixth.
Mark Broughman of Hillsdale MI. was forced to
start the feature in twenty-forth position but ran a
very strong race finishing in the seventh position.
Kyle Patrick of Tilbury was strong early on but
dropped back late in the race to finish in eight.
Garry Evans of London and Dempster were both
involved in spins that put to the rear of the field but
they would bounce back to finish ninth and tenth
respectively.
Heat
race winners on the night were Patrick, West and
Dempster with West also picking up the checkered in the
Dash for Cash.
